1.  Basic method of near field measurement

At present, in the field of antenna near-field measurement, the commonly used antenna measurement methods include plane scanning, cylindrical scanning and spherical scanning. These methods need to collect data on plane, cylindrical and spherical respectively.

2.  Characteristics of near field measurement method
Planar near-field scanning requires smaller darkroom environment, simpler adjustment technology and mathematical analysis. This technology is suitable for high directivity antenna measurement, such as butterfly or phased array. Almost all received or transmitted energy passes through the plane scanning area. However, the plane near-field only covers a limited area of the antenna pattern to be measured, so it is difficult to measure the directivity of the antenna.

Cylindrical near-field scanning is suitable for sector beam antenna measurement. Its energy is concentrated in one axis and dispersed in the other orthogonal axis. For example, the radiation pattern of mobile phone base station antenna is mostly limited to a small range in the pitch direction.

Spherical near-field scanning can be used for the measurement of any antenna, especially for omnidirectional or approximate omnidirectional antennas that are not suitable for plane and cylindrical measurement. This method has no truncation of the measurement surface, so it can be used to accurately measure the far sidelobe of any type of antenna.
